My Story

My love for photography began in childhood, when my Grandma gave me my first camera. That early gift planted a creative seed that took root years later while I was studying Graphic Design at 18 — the moment I truly discovered the power of visual storytelling. Since then, I’ve built a career spanning over 15 years, working across portraiture, marketing, landscapes, and wildlife.

 

In 2023, I made a pivotal change: I gave up traditional living and embraced life on the road, committing fully to the outdoors, climbing, and the freedom to create. Now living in my van, I travel with the seasons—chasing light, rock, and inspiring stories.

 

As a climbing photographer with specialised rope training, I capture the emotion and energy of climbers in their element. Whether I’m hanging on a rope to catch the shot, trekking at dawn for the perfect light, or shaping a narrative for print, I immerse myself in every project with excitement and passion.

 

Alongside photography, I write and shoot editorial features for magazines, focusing on climbing, travel, and nature. I also collaborate with outdoor brands to create authentic content—photographing and reviewing products in the field, crafting compelling narratives, and building visual assets that resonate with real-world adventure.

 

Beyond the lens, I support businesses through digital coordination services, including website management, newsletter creation, and social media strategy. With a background in design and content creation, I help brands stay consistent, connected, and aligned with their story across all platforms.

 

I also create framed photographic prints for hotels and corporate spaces, helping to bring a sense of calm and connection to the natural world indoors.

 

For me, photography is more than a profession — it’s a way of life, built on curiosity, creativity, and a love for the wild.
